Carolyn Sue "Suzy" McCool Cotham, age 69. Born July 16, 1945 in Tuckerman, Ark., to Jim Berry McCool and Patricia Lucille Mitchell McCool. Suzy died Wednesday, June 24, 2015 at home in Scott, Ark. after succumbing to ALS. She is survived by her husband, William H. Cotham. Together they were the founders and original owners of "Cotham's Country Store" restaurant (home of the famous "hubcap hamburger"), which received national acclaim in such publications as Southern Living Magazine. She was also survived by her son, Neil Cotham and wife Maggie; her sisters, Merle Lee McCool Dyke and husband Wallace, Norris Anne McCool Neighbors and husband Bill; brother, James Mitchell Winningham and wife Diane; and sister-in-law, Helen McCool; as well as a number of nieces and nephews. Suzy was preceded in death by her parents; her brothers, Jack McCool, Mac McCool; and sister, Zadie Jo McCool Dilday. Known for her great compassion, she will be missed by numerous friends in Arkansas and other states.
